My client is a Leading, Tier 1 Civil Engineering Contractor.

Due to an internal promotion and planned and continued growth they are looking to appoint, on a permanent basis a Planning Manager to work on a wide variety of Heavy Civil Engineering Projects which could be in any of the following sectors; Energy, Rail, Motorways, Wind Farms, Flood schemes, Ports & Marine, Substations and much more.

Job Role:

  • The Planning Manager will support the Head of Planning within the Pre-Construction Planning team
  • They will lead the development and production of a tender programmes and supporting information; ensuring it complies with the Contract and Works Information.

Responsibilities:

  • Manage the planning on the tender to produce the plan and programme for submission.
  • Communicate the plan to everyone involved including external stakeholders.
  • Ensure the plan and programme incorporate allowance for safe working methods and timely construction.
  • Identify risk to the programme, make time risk allowance in the programme and contribute to the tender risk and opportunity schedule/register.
  • Communicate and gain approval from the bid/project team, the methods proposed and the sequence of the plan utilizing visual aids and graphics developed from concept and detailed drawings.
  • Liaise and negotiate with suppliers communicating proposed methods and sequence.
  • Assist the bid team to evaluate supply chain quotations/methodologies that relate to programme.
  • Manage the resource and cost loading of the programmes in liaison with the Estimating team to produce a commercial forecast if required.
